Transaction 89d84a779a27fde728e77f7c21e351c7aa9e92b7374f524fc19279d310f56627
1 Input
1 Output
-
89d84a779a27fde728e77f7c21e351c7aa9e92b7374f524fc19279d310f56627:0
- value
- 281122
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 728eac232889ee931c127c0b87405050e6f491f2 OP_EQUAL
- address
- 3C8jsTwieyQWYTjFzBCKnMQPNtFTKPFrFb